Family says the wrong person is behind bars. We get the latest tonight from nbc. Reporter shaking his head as the charges were listed. Four counts of endangerment Reporter Police say the suspect Leslie Allen Merritt jr. A 21yearold landscaper terrorized drivers along i10. He was arrested friday night at this walmart. All i have to say is that im the wrong guy. I tried telling the detectives that. My guns been in the pawn shop for the last two months. I havent even had access to a weapon. Reporter his bond set at 1 million. I could never afford that bond. I got two kids. Reporter police say merritts gun was linked to the first four of the highway shootings. And according to a court document, the gun was not in pawn status during the time of the shootings. The crime lab testfired the firearm pawned by what we believe to be mr. Merritt. The testfired bullets were matched to bullet fragments from four casings over the last weekend in august. Reporter investigators say merritt sold the gun
